Vice President for Administration & Corporate Compliance Officer
Liberty Resources Inc
Syracuse, NY

 

Liberty Resources seeks a Vice President to join our team and play a key role in driving innovation, efficiency, and compliance across our organization. This role will focus on technology, quality (QA/QI), Compliance, and people. This role is a strategic partner to Executive Leadership and is critical in ensuring that the organization's administrative functions are aligned with its strategic objectives and that operational processes are efficient, compliant, and supportive of overall organizational success.

The functions of this role include:

IN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Y (IT)

  • In concert with the IT Directors, oversee all aspects of an organization's IT infrastructure, Business Intelligence, Health Information Technology, and other systems and strategies.
  • Provide oversight in developing and executing the organization's IT strategy in alignment with overall business objectives.
  • Formulate long-term plans to leverage technology effectively to support the company's growth and competitiveness.
  • Facilitate the organization's EHR strategy in alignment with its overall goals and objectives. This involves assessing the organization's current EHR needs, capabilities, and infrastructure and evaluating emerging technologies and industry trends.
  • Develop and lead IT Project Prioritization Committee to effectively manage team resources and meet business need
  • Collaborate with other senior leaders, clinicians, and IT professionals to define requirements, select appropriate EHR systems, and develop implementation plans.
  • Oversee the deployment and integration of EHR systems and ensure the optimization and usability of EHR systems to enhance patient care, efficiency, and outcomes.
  • Lead initiatives to streamline workflows, customize EHR configurations, and implement best practices for data entry and documentation.
  • Assess the organization's data needs, capabilities, and technology infrastructure to determine the most effective BI solutions.
  • Work with the Director of Business Intelligence to support and promote data governance across the organization.
  • Define KPIs and metrics in concert with Divisional VP. to measure the success of BI initiatives and ensure alignment with overall business performance goals.
  • Work with the Director of Business Intelligence to collect, process, and analyze data from various sources to uncover trends, patterns, and opportunities. Provide direction to design data visualization tools, dashboards, and reports that communicate insights effectively to stakeholders across the organization.
  • Oversee the implementation, maintenance, and security of IT systems, networks, and infrastructure to ensure reliability, availability, and performance.
  • Manage IT budgets, vendor relationships, and compliance with relevant regulations and standards.
  • Aide in the implementation of  IT service management processes, such as ITIL, to ensure that IT services meet the needs of the organization and its stakeholders.
  • Engage stakeholders early in the process to ensure their buy-in and support for the new IT policies. Encourage feedback and participation from stakeholders throughout the implementation process to ensure a smooth transition and successful adoption of the new systems.

QUALITY

  • Develop and implement a comprehensive quality strategy aligned with the organization's goals and objectives. This includes defining quality standards, policies, and procedures to ensure products or services meet or exceed customer expectations.
  • Oversee the establishment of quality met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ure and monitor quality performance across the organization.
  • Lead efforts to drive continuous improvement throughout the organization. Identify areas for improvement in processes, systems, and products/services, and implement initiatives to enhance quality, efficiency, and effectiveness.
  • Deploy quality management methodologies and foster a culture of continuous learning and innovation among employees to achieve operational excellence.
  • Drive performance improvement for quality metrics and processes, including activities related to National Committee for Quality Assurance (NCQA) Accreditation and Healthcare Effectiveness Data and Information Set (HEDIS) performance.

CORPORATE COMPLIANCE

  • Function as Corporate Compliance Officer related to all Regulatory Bodies
  • Ensure that the organization operates within legal and regulatory frameworks, implementing policies and procedures to mitigate risks of non-compliance with laws and regulations relevant to the industry.
  • Foster a culture of integrity and ethical behavior within the company, developing and implementing programs to educate employees on standards and provide guidance on ethical dilemmas that may arise in business operations.
  • In coordination with the Quality Assurance/Improvement department, oversee investigations, follow-up, and, as applicable, resolutions, including developing and implementing corrective action plans and improvement initiatives for all compliance-related issues.
  • Develop and oversee internal and external audit procedures to monitor and detect misconduct or noncompliance, in collaboration with the quality assurance/quality improvement department.
  • Convene and lead the Agency’s Corporate Compliance Committee

HUMAN RESOURCES

  • Work with the Director of HR to ensure that HR initiatives support the organization's strategic goals and priorities in workforce planning, talent acquisition, retention, and development.
  • Ensure the development of HR policies, programs, and practices that promote fair treatment, respect, and trust among employees, including employee communications, conflict resolution processes, and feedback mechanisms to address concerns and improve workplace satisfaction.
  • Foster a positive organizational culture that values diversity, equity, and inclusion.

 Qualifications:

  • Education: A Master's degree in a relevant field, such as business administration, healthcare, quality management, or a related discipline, is strongly preferred.
  • Experience: Extensive experience in quality management, IT management, process improvement, and leadership roles is crucial. This should include at least 10 years of progressively responsible roles in quality assurance and improvement, information technology, or related areas. Experience in regulatory compliance, quality standards (e.g., ISO, Six Sigma, Lean), and risk management is highly valued.
  • Leadership Skills: Strong leadership abilities are essential to effectively leading and inspiring teams, driving organizational change, and fostering a culture of quality excellence. Experience in managing cross-functional teams, developing talent, and influencing stakeholders at all levels of the organization is critical.
  • Strategic Vision: This person must be competent to develop and implement a strategic vision for quality management aligned with the organization's goals and objectives.
  • Regulatory Knowledge: This person should understand regulatory requirements and compliance standards in New York State, preferably in a healthcare environment.
  • Analytical Skills: Strong analytical and problem-solving skills are necessary for identifying root causes of quality issues, analyzing data to drive decision-making, and measuring the effectiveness of quality initiatives.
  • Communication Skills: Effective communication skills, both verbal and written, are critical to articulate strategies, engage stakeholders, and drive alignment across the organization.
  • Integrity and Ethics: Given the critical role of ensuring product and service quality, this person must demonstrate high levels of integrity, ethics, and professionalism.
